Prep Time:15 mins
Cook Time:30 mins
Total Time:45 mins
Servings: 6

Ingredients

  • 6 cups Fresh broccoli florets
  • 3 tablespoons Unsalted butter
  • 1 medium Yellow onion, finely chopped
  • 3 cloves Garlic, minced
  • 3 tablespoons All-purpose flour
  • 2 cups Milk
  • 2 cups Cheddar cheese, shredded
  • 4 ounces Cream cheese, softened
  • 1 teaspoon Salt
  • 0.5 teaspoons Black pepper
  • 0.5 teaspoons Ground mustard (optional)
  • 0.25 teaspoons Paprika (for garnish)
  • 0.5 cups Breadcrumbs
  • 0.25 cups Parmesan cheese, grated
  • 1 tablespoon Olive oil

Directions

Step 1

Preheat your oven to 375°F (190°C). Lightly grease a 9x13-inch baking dish and set aside.

Step 2

Bring a large pot of salted water to a boil. Add the broccoli florets and blanch for 2-3 minutes until they are bright green and slightly tender. Drain and set aside.

Step 3

In a medium saucepan, melt the butter over medium heat. Add the chopped onion and cook until softened, about 3-4 minutes. Add the minced garlic and cook for an additional minute.

Step 4

Sprinkle the flour over the onion mixture and whisk to combine. Cook for 1-2 minutes to eliminate any raw flour taste.

Step 5

Slowly whisk in the milk, ensuring there are no lumps. Cook and stir until the mixture thickens slightly, about 4-5 minutes.

Step 6

Reduce the heat to low and stir in the shredded cheddar cheese, cream cheese, salt, black pepper, and ground mustard (if using). Stir until the cheeses are fully melted and the sauce is smooth.

Step 7

Add the blanched broccoli florets to the cheese sauce, stirring gently to coat all pieces evenly.

Step 8

Pour the broccoli and cheese mixture into the prepared baking dish, spreading it out evenly.

Step 9

In a small bowl, combine the breadcrumbs, grated Parmesan cheese, and olive oil. Mix until the breadcrumbs are evenly coated. Sprinkle this mixture over the casserole.

Step 10

Lightly dust the top with paprika for a festive look.

Step 11

Bake in the preheated oven for 20-25 minutes, or until the top is golden brown and the casserole is bubbling.

Step 12

Remove from the oven and let it rest for about 5 minutes before serving. Enjoy!
